Denise earns $30 an hour. She works 40 hours per week. A. Create and solve an expression to represent how much money Denise earns in a week.

Sagot :

Answer:

$1,200

Step-by-step explanation:

Let x be the hours Denise works in a week, and y be her earnings per week.

y = ($30/hr)(x)

For a 40 hour week, Denise earns:

y = ($30/hr)(40 hr/week)

y = $1,200 in a week.
